The Role

As a Class 2 driver, you’ll be responsible for collecting waste along a set route, working alongside a team to ensure efficient and timely collections.

What Your Day Looks Like

  • Early starts between 5:00 AM – 6:00 AM
  • 7.5-hour shifts with early finishes
  • Driving a Class 2 vehicle
  • Hands-on work including lifting and loading bin bags

What We’re Looking For

  • Full UK driving licence with Class 2 (Cat C) entitlement
  • Valid CPC & Digi Tacho card
  • Minimum 6 months Class 2 driving experience
  • Good level of fitness (this is a physical role)
  • Reliable, punctual, and team-oriented
  • Own transport to commute to site
